The unexpected Olympic 100-meter champion from Tokyo, Marcell Jacobs, stated on Wednesday that if he can find “that spark again,” he may extend his career until the 2028 Los Angeles Games. “I would like to have a clear situation that would allow me to train at 100% if I were ever to find that spark again – the one I’m trying at all costs to re-light,” Jacobs, 31, said to Sky Sport Italia. In that scenario, it would last for at least three years rather than only one. Los Angeles 2028 would be the objective, the Italian continued.
